Searching...
Coast To Coast Restaurant Equipment
13201 S Belcher Rd Suite # 1, Largo, FL
Oishii Fondue Hotpot And Sushi Bar
10500 Ulmerton Road, Largo, FL
Benedict's Restaurant
201 W Bay Dr, Largo, FL
Fresno 2 Gourmet Deli
31 Loisaida Ave, New York, NY